Adra ( Spanish: Adra ) - a settlement and municipality in Spain , part of the province of Almeria , as part of the autonomous community of Andalusia . The municipality is part of the Poniente Almeriense district ( mosquito ). It covers an area of 90 km². The population of 24,713 people (for 2016 ). Distance 53 km to the provincial capital.
